
Covenant University is one of the private Universities in Nigeria. The school has developed a software that can help to check the menace of illegal possession of arms and its proliferation in the country.
The software is known as the “Radio Frequency Identification (RID) Enabled Ammunition Depot Management System’’ which was actually displayed at an exhibition organised by the Nigerian Air Force (NAF) Research and Development centre to showcase NAF’s efforts in equipment maintenance and management, in Abuja on Tuesday.
The software which was developed at the University in August is to show the school's ability and capability in the area of research and development
